Default Stay Away From FL -- Best Advise

If you are planning or you are aleady underway via the ICW or ocean to
mid east coast of Florida or to FL west coast north of Ft. Meyers and
to Panhandle area of NW FL and west, the best advise anyone can give
and take is to stay away. The people whose marinas and boats were
damaged do not now need your business. They need time and energy to
recover from recent storms.

For your own safety and for your boat's safety, channel markers are
often missing or moved, channels and bottoms have often changed
(sometimes dramatically) from severe silting and and so charts are
useless, debris litters the ICW and channels off of ICW. Many bascule
bridges on ICW are damaged and currently inoperative. Most marinas are
badly damaged or destroyed, electric power is still out, fuel supply
is at best spotty and uncertain, water supply and sanitary facilities
are often unavailable or tenuous, etc. Dredges and barges are working
to make repairs and to recover beached and sunken boats (thousands),
but they need space for meanueverability. They do not now need any
boat traffic to contend with.

If you still believe none of this applies to you, please stay in the
ocean and Gulf along FL coasts and head S directly to Ft, Lauderdale
or to Miami and the FL Keys or N and W in the Gulf of Mexico N of Ft.
Meyers to ports west of Mobile AL.

Most of FL is not now the place to go. Give us a chance to recover our
stressed out lives, properties and businesses. And donate to
charities!
